Anantara Siam Bangkok Completes THB 1.6 Billion Transformation
Anantara Siam Bangkok Hotel has invested more than THB 1.6 billion (approximately USD 50 million) in a transformation of the hotel, covering all 335 guestrooms and suites, restaurants and bars, meeting and event spaces, public areas and wellness facilities. Songtei Kyoto, Shangri-La Signatures to Open in Late 2026
Shangri-La Group will open Songtei Kyoto, Shangri-La Signatures in late 2026, marking the collection’s second property. Located opposite Nijo Castle, a UNESCO World Heritage Site in Kyoto, Japan, the 77-key hotel will welcome its first guests from late 2026. The Parisian Macao Marks 10 Years on Cotai Strip
The Parisian Macao will mark its 10th anniversary on Sept. 13, marking a decade since the integrated resort opened on the Cotai Strip. Since opening in 2016, the property has welcomed more than 100 million visitors, according to Sands China. Vipul Misra Appointed Acting CEO of SriLankan Airlines
Vipul Misra has been appointed Acting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of SriLankan Airlines, effective September 9. Misra brings more than two decades of experience in aircraft engineering and aviation leadership. IHG and Alphanam Group Announce InterContinental Branded Residences in Sapa
IHG Hotels & Resorts (IHG) and Alphanam Group have announced plans for The Residences at InterContinental Sapa Resort, marking the debut of InterContinental branded residences in northwest Vietnam. Metropole Monte-Carlo Appoints Laurent Herschbach as General Manager
Metropole Monte-Carlo has appointed Laurent Herschbach as General Manager, effective October 1, 2026. Herschbach joins the Monaco hotel after 30 years at the Ritz Paris, bringing experience across hotel operations and senior management.
